logo

Output e17d1bf222cc5a5c3a685dc3c008884ec430f34f7c56b8ba32106e15c6da1141:0

value
18316041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d2172c955f545027c68a7aedf47e5882c00fc4 OP_EQUAL
address
3KBGfXdR4WJY7gSfSP1NHh3b548AM7sSqs
transaction
e17d1bf222cc5a5c3a685dc3c008884ec430f34f7c56b8ba32106e15c6da1141